Former Team India skipper Dattajirao Gaekwad passed away at the age of 95 years in Baroda. Having made his debut in 1952, he ammassed 350 runs from 11 Tests for the national side. He was the longest living Indian cricketer.
Dattajirao Gaekwad no more
Gaekwad amassed 5788 first-class runs from 110 matches, with a highest score of 249 not-out.
